What is Double Glazing?
Before diving into quotes, it's important to understand what double glazing entails. Double glazing describes a window building and construction method where two panes of glass are separated by an air or gas-filled space. This style provides increased insulation compared to single-pane windows.
Advantages of Double Glazing
- Energy Efficiency: Reduces heat loss, decreasing energy bills.
- Noise Reduction: Minimizes external sound, producing a quieter indoor environment.
- Enhanced Security: Toughened glass is harder to break, making homes more safe and secure.
- Condensation Reduction: Reduces moisture accumulation on windows.
- Increased Property Value: Enhances aesthetic appeal and energy performance, possibly increasing property value.
The Importance of Detailed Quotes
When thinking about double glazing, acquiring multiple quotes is crucial. Not only does this allow house owners to compare prices, but it likewise helps them comprehend the different services and products available. An extensive quote should consist of information such as:
- Type of glass
- Frame products
- Installation expenses
- Warranty details
- Energy scores

How to Get Double Glazing Quotes
1. Research Study Local Installers
Start by looking into local double glazing companies. Search for companies with positive evaluations, proper licenses, and an excellent performance history. Suggestions from family and friends can also be invaluable.
2. Arrange In-Home Consultations
Many trusted business offer totally free consultations. Throughout these gos to, installers can evaluate your home, discuss your requirements, and provide customized quotes.
3. Ask Questions
When conference with installers, do not think twice to ask questions. Key inquiries might include:
- What brands of glass and frames do you suggest?
- Are your installers accredited?
- What financing options are offered?
- Can you provide references from previous customers?
4. Compare Quotes
After receiving quotes, compare them side by side. Look not just at rates however also at the quality of materials and client service provided. This can frequently reveal significant distinctions.
Elements Influencing Double Glazing Quotes
Comprehending what affects the expense of double glazing can assist homeowners determine which components are essential for their requirements. Here are some elements that can affect quotes:
1. Type of Glass
The type of glass utilized considerably impacts the rate. For instance, energy-efficient Low-E glass might be more expensive however can lead to savings on energy bills in the long run.
2. Frame Materials
The option of frame (e.g., uPVC, wood, aluminum) can cause varying costs. While uPVC is often the most cost effective alternative, wood frames offer a timeless aesthetic but might feature a greater price.
3. Installation Complexity
The intricacy of the installation, including the size of the windows and the condition of the existing frame, can affect expenses. More complicated setups will generally increase the total price.
4. Area
Geographical area can also contribute in rates. Urban locations might have greater labor costs, while rural areas might have fewer installer choices, affecting competition and prices.
5. Additional Features

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the typical expense of double glazing?
The average expense can vary commonly depending upon the elements pointed out, generally varying from ₤ 400 to ₤ 1,200 per window, including installation.
How long does double glazing last?
Quality double glazing can last in between 20 to 35 years, depending upon the material and maintenance practices.
Are there any grants or financial assistance programs for double glazing?
Yes, numerous energy efficiency programs might use grants or financial backing for homeowners wanting to enhance their home's energy effectiveness, including double glazing. It's suggested to consult local government sites or energy providers for readily available options.
What is the energy score, and why is it crucial?
The energy ranking shows how energy-efficient a window is, usually on a scale from A++ to E. Higher-rated windows will offer better insulation, causing lower energy costs.
Can I install double glazing myself?
While it is technically possible for experienced DIYers to install double glazing themselves, it is usually suggested to hire professionals to ensure appropriate installation and compliance with building policies.
